Woolaston Carnival 2026
- Date: Saturday 4th July 2026
- Location: Woolaston Playing Field, Woolaston, Forest of Dean, Gloucestershire
- Price: Free entry (some activities and stalls may charge)
- Dogs: Yes, well-behaved dogs on leads welcome
- Contact: Woolaston Memorial Hall Committee
Woolaston Carnival is a much-loved annual event bringing the whole community together for a day of fun, entertainment and celebration.
The event usually includes a colourful carnival procession through the village, followed by a packed programme of activities on the playing field.
Visitors can expect live entertainment, stalls, games, refreshments, children’s activities and a great community atmosphere.
What happens on the day?
The day typically starts with a parade through the village, followed by an afternoon of activities, performances and stalls on the carnival field.
Is it suitable for families?
Yes - Woolaston Carnival is very family-friendly, with plenty of activities for children alongside food and entertainment for all ages.
Parking: Limited village parking is available - arrive early where possible or walk if you’re local.
Top tip: Bring cash for stalls and activities, and arrive early to enjoy the parade.
